June 24, 2023 Lisette Esther Ferrer United States View in Decentralized Storage Date Of Birth: August 23, 1977 Date Of Death: November 6, 2016 State: New Jersey Source link
June 24, 2023 Lisette Esther Ferrer United States View in Decentralized Storage Date Of Birth: August 23, 1977 Date Of Death: November 6, 2016 State: New Jersey Source link